Amazing past. Exciting future.

Our story is one of innovation, drive, vision and progress. Since our inception nearly 100 years ago, we have led the way in the design, development, and manufacture of acrylic polymers and resins. From our beginnings in the UK to production in Japan and the first production of Acrylic Resin in the U.S., we have always looked forward. Take a look at our timeline to discover more.
1960
1960 DuPont Developed Elvacite™ for coatings, inks, and adhesives, produced at the Parkersburg, WV plant.
1970
1973 MRC Beads Resin
Production begins in Japan
1980
1988 Bonar Renamed Bonar Polymers; started production at Newton Aycliffe, Co. Durham, UK.
1990
1990 Bonar Manufactured coating grades for “Lucite Holland” on a toll basis.
1990 Dianal America Ground-Breaking of “Dianal America, Inc” by Mitsubishi Rayon Corp (MRC)
1992 ICI Acrylics Acquired DuPont acrylics, including the “Lucite™” and “Elvacite™” brands, and production in Parkersburg, WV. Transferred Billingham, UK. plant production to Bonar.
1992 Dianal America First production of Acrylic Resin in USA
1993 ICI Acquired acrylic resins business from DuPont, consolidating operations at Parkersburg, WV.
1999 ICI Acrylics Acquired by Ineos and renamed to Ineos Acrylics, eventually becoming Lucite International.
2000
2000 Ineos Acquired Bonar Polymers, bringing Elvacite™ production to the Newton Aycliffe site to improve European market service.
2001 MRC/DIAP Started production in Thailand
2002 Ineos Spun off Lucite International.
2008 MRC Acquired Lucite International.
2009 MCC & MRC Mitsubishi Chemical Corporation acquires Mitsubishi Rayon Co.
2010
2015 MRC Project Voyager: Ceased Elvacite™ bead resin production in Parkersburg, transferring production to Pasadena, TX; Hiroshima, JP; and Newton Aycliffe, UK.
2017 Mitsubishi Rayon Merged into Mitsubishi Chemical Corporation, integrating Lucite International.
2018 MCA & DuPont Stopped manufacturing of Lucite®/Elvacite™ at Lucite facility -- production moved to Dianal America and MCC Hiroshima
2019 Lucite International Expanded Elvacite™ production in Europe in Rozenburg, NL, producing Elvacite® 2016 and 2013.
2020
2020 Dianal America Dianal America, Inc. name change to Mitsubishi Chemical America, Inc. Specialty Resins Division
2021 Mitsubishi Chemical UK Renamed Lucite International Specialty Polymers and Resins to Mitsubishi Chemical UK Limited Specialty Polymers and Resins.
2025
2025 Dianal brand consolidated with Elvacite™ for a singular bead resins brand for MCG
